Yarrawonga-Mulwala RSL Sub-Branch is holding ANZAC Day Ceremonies on Sunday 22nd April for Lake Rowan at 10.00am, St. James at 12 noon and Tungamah at 2.00pm. The Bus will depart from ClubMulwala at 9:15am. RSL Members Smoko night will be held on Tuesday 24th April at ClubMulwala. Comradeship at 5.30pm with Dinner at 6.30pm. Please book at ClubMulwala Reception. ANZAC Day Services will be held on Wednesday 25th April Dawn Service will commence at 6.00am sharp at the Memorial wall located at the front of ClubMulwala in Melbourne Street, Mulwala and will be followed by a “Gunfire” breakfast at 7.00am at the Club for all attending. Services will be held for both Mulwala and Yarrawonga Mulwala – form up opposite Hicks Butchery at 9.15am. March off will commence at 9.30am sharp. Yarrawonga form up outside Old Fire Station in Piper Street at 10.45am. March off will commence at 11.00am sharp. Comradeship at ClubMulwala following the Yarrawonga march. North East Water

information WATER ACT 1989 NORTH EAST REGION WATER CORPORATION Extension of Yarrawonga Waterworks District and Yarrawonga Sewerage District for the township of Bundalong Notice is hereby given that the North East Region Water Corporation, pursuant to Section 122 of the Water Act 1989, proposes to seek to extend the Yarrawonga Waterworks District and Yarrawonga Sewerage District. This is in line with the additional connections to the sewer, growth which has occurred and the proposed Bundalong Dual Water Supply Scheme. Full details of the proposed water district and sewerage district proposals and plans showing the extent of the districts are available for inspection free of charge at the Corporation’s office, Level 1, Hovell Street, Wodonga, during office hours. Members of the public are invited to make submissions on the proposal. Any person making a submission or objection to the proposal should set out grounds for any objection raised in the submission. Submissions must be received by the Corporation on or before the 11th May 2012, which is one month after the publication of this notice for consideration by the Board. Craig Heiner Managing Director North East Water North East Water PO Box 863 Wodonga Vic 3689 Ph: 1300 361 622

GORDON DUNCAN BRIDGE REPAIR A contractor will be undertaking repair to the damaged handrails on Gordon Duncan Bridge on Minns Road after Easter and the work is anticipated to take 2 weeks – weather permitting. The bridge will not be closed to normal traffic, although some minor delays may be experienced. However, due to the nature of the work, one lane will be closed infrequently and it would be appreciated if wide farm machinery would refrain from using this route whilst work is in progress.
